From 4ea915fc3a6ee18020165ee935c717ac043e58da Mon Sep 17 00:00:00 2001 From: David Wilcox Date: Thu, 24 Nov 2016 11:57:47 +1100 Subject: [PATCH] Update Cloudformation/parsing#load_parameters to split commadelimitedlists into lists (#774) --- moto/cloudformation/parsing.py | 2 ++ 1 file changed, 2 insertions(+) diff --git a/moto/cloudformation/parsing.py b/moto/cloudformation/parsing.py index 06b460495..971adbbf6 100644 --- a/moto/cloudformation/parsing.py +++ b/moto/cloudformation/parsing.py @@ -329,6 +329,8 @@ class ResourceMap(collections.Mapping): # Set any input parameters that were passed for key, value in self.input_parameters.items(): if key in self.resolved_parameters: + if parameter_slots[key].get('Type', 'String') == 'CommaDelimitedList': + value = value.split(',') self.resolved_parameters[key] = value # Check if there are any non-default params that were not passed input params